Here are some of the most popular Haitian dishes:
- Soup joumou. This is a traditional Haitian pumpkin soup. It is often eaten on New Year’s Day to celebrate Haiti’s independence.
- Griot. This is a dish of fried pork. It is often served with rice and beans.
- Poulet Creole. This is a dish of chicken stewed in a tomato-based sauce. It is often served with rice and beans.
- Diri ak pwa. This is a dish of rice and beans. It is a staple of the Haitian diet.
- Pikliz. This is a spicy Haitian slaw. It is often served as a side dish.

What are some of the unique ingredients used in Haitian cuisine?
Some of the unique ingredients used in Haitian cuisine include Scotch bonnet peppers, epis (a Haitian spice blend), and cassava.
